The configuration for Site A and B are shown below. In this example, Site B uses its primary access point to act as an access point for Virtual
Stations on Site A and D, and uses a Virtual Station to act as a client to Site C. Site A uses two Virtual Stations to act as clients to
Site B and to Site C.
Site B configuration – Network Page configured as Primary Access Point
Site B WDS configuration - Repeaters Page configured with Virtual Station to Site C
Site A&D WDS configuration - Repeaters Page configured with two Virtual Clients to Sites B & C.
Encryption levels and key above are shows as being different however they can be the same as in some of the earlier examples. One reason why
the Encryption level and key would be different is because the Access Point may have clients that communicate using a different Encryption
method e.g. 128 bit WEP and may not support the same Encryption method.
